The Jakarta Post, Feb. 17's letter on plagiarism has opened a
Pandora's box. How can The Jakarta Post prevent this widespread
phenomenon?
Universities are also having to cope with this enormous task
of detecting such dishonesty in education. A method of
computerized finger-printing has been invented and can be
obtained on the web: http://plagiarism.org/ from U.C. Berkeley.
They provide a service to detect originality of wordings and
ideas compared to over 800 million publications on accessible
Internet pages. It also reports that the quality of students'
work increases when they know that manuscripts will be checked
for originality. Furthermore, it states that "unchecked cheating
and plagiarism by others undermine their (the students) own
efforts and educational enthusiasm".
